Opposition Leader, Datin Seri Wan Azizah Wan Ismail, has filed notice with the Dewan Rakyat to table a motion of no confidence against the Prime Minister. This is an unprecedented move and it is still unclear whether the Speaker of the Parliament, who has almost absolute discretion in deciding whether or not motions may be tabled, would allow it.
By the convention of the British Parliament, in which our Westminster system of government is based upon, a government which fails to win confidence by the responsible house (ie. the house of Parliament that's directly elected by the people, in our case the Dewan Rakyat), would either be compelled to :
- Resign, or
- Seek the dissolution of Parliament and call for new elections, failing which it has to resign and allow the head of state to appoint a new government led by a member of Parliament whom the head of state feels has the confidence of Parliament
